Consumer awareness has increased concerning castration of piglets without analgesia or anaesthesia. On the other hand the occurrence of boar taint is not tolerated by consumers. Currently no reliable methods exist for the on-line detection of boar taint in the slaughterhouse or for genetic sexing of pigs. Therefore, as an alternative the detection of male pork meat was sought. Based on detection of a length polymorphism of the sex chromosomal amelogenin gene a reliable, specific and highly sensitive PCR method for qualitative and semi-quantitative determination of male pork tissue in meat and meat products was determined. A set of 25 male and 25 female meat samples could be correctly identified and mixtures with as little as 0.1% male meat content could be detected. Therefore the method can be used for production and control of specific meat products containing low amounts of male pork meat and thus avoiding boar taint.  相似文献

Our research explored the relative importance of pig castration amongst other aspects of animal welfare, and the potential impact of information and sensory experiences on European Union (EU) consumers' preferences. The EU is considering a future ban on surgical pig castration by 2018 which may affect markets and consumers' preferences. We carried out an empirical study using consumer-level data obtained from questionnaires completed in a controlled environment by a total of 825 consumers. The experiment was carried out in six EU countries (Spain, United Kingdom, The Netherlands, France, Italy and Germany) which account for 66.0% of the EU-27's and 76.3% of the EU-15's meat production. Results show that consumers do not perceive pig castration to be a relevant aspect of animal welfare nor its relationship with meat quality. Consumers with healthy life styles, concerned about animal welfare and who have had a negative sensory experience with boar meat are willing to accept paying more to avoid boar taint.  相似文献

Twenty-nine crossbred boars were used to evaluate the effects of live weight and processing on the sensory attributes and concentrations of androstenedione and androstenone (boar taint) in boar meat. Boars were stratified by litter across six weight group endpoints (90.9, 95.5, 100.0, 104.5, 109.1, and 113.6 kg). Back fat and longissimus muscle from the lumbar region were used for androstenone determination, proximate analysis and sensory evaluation. Hams were cured for sensory analysis and were used to determine androstenone concentrations. Androstenone as an off-flavor did not differ (P > 0.05) among treatments for longissimus lean or cured hams and was found to be in the “threshold” to “none detected” range. Back fat androstenone concentration was positively correlated (P < 0.05) to hot carcass weight, however, lean androstenone concentration was not (P > 0.05). No relationship was found (P > 0.05) between androstenone concentration and days on feed, average daily gain or androstenedione concentration. Additionally, further processing decreased androstenone concentration by approximately 29%.  相似文献

Five heating methods (microwave, hotwire, boiling at 25 °C and 75 °C and melting) were used to generate cooking odours from backfat of entire male pigs and a 'composite' sample consisting of fat and muscle from the head along with salivary glands. The methods elicited significantly different scores for odours from 4 groups of 10 samples differing in their concentrations and ratios of skatole and androstenone. The odours (pork odour, abnormal odour, skatole odour and androstenone odour) were assessed by 3 experienced assessors. Correlations between skatole and androstenone concentrations and abnormal odour score in backfat were higher for skatole, suggesting it is the more important boar taint compound. In the composite sample, androstenone concentration was much higher than in backfat and androstenone was a more important contributor to boar taint. The microwave, hotwire and boiling (75 °C) methods produced the clearest separation between samples and the microwave method was considered the most suitable for on-line use.  相似文献

Dynamic Head Space methodology was applied to evaluate the possible contribution of some volatile compounds to the development of boar taint in pig backfat samples with low concentrations of skatole and androstenone, but which had previously been classified as tainted by a trained test panel. Volatile compounds were collected in a trap of graphited charcoal and analysed by GC–MS in Scan mode. Aldehydes and short chain fatty acids, compounds that play a significant role in the development of undesirable aromas in food products, were the main classes of compounds identified in this study, although the possible contribution of other compounds that were detected in a minor proportion – such as alcohols and ketones – was evaluated. Styrene and 1,4-dichlorobenzene, compounds that may have come from an external contamination, showed a high concentration in the samples classified with boar taint, so these compounds could have been responsible for the development of some off-flavours in the fat samples studied in this work. In the same study, skatole and androstenone were also determined by normal phase HPLC and GCMS, respectively.  相似文献

The purpose of Workpackage 3 of the European Eupigclass project was to test indirect methods of measuring the lean meat percentage of a carcass that would be less costly, at least as accurate and more consistent than dissection. Magnetic resonance imaging was one of the three indirect methods tested to measure the lean meat weight and the lean meat percentage of pig carcasses, the other methods being X-ray CT and vision techniques. One hundred and twenty carcasses from three different genotypes and from both sexes were slaughtered. The left parts of the carcasses were fully dissected and the right parts were investigated with an indirect method using a 1.5T MRI system. The acquisition protocol was chosen to give an optimized contrast between fat and muscle tissues. Two different approaches, image segmentation and PLS regression, were used to extract information from the images. Automatic image segmentation was performed to quantify the volume of muscle in the images and gave a standard error of prediction using a linear regression with the dissection of the left half carcasses of 586 g and 1.10% for lean meat weight and lean meat percentage, respectively. PLS regression using the signal intensities histograms gave an estimation error of 465 g for lean meat weight. These results showed that MRI could be used in place of full dissection for authorizing and monitoring classification equipment of pig carcasses.  相似文献

This study aimed at evaluating the effect of housing system (HS), slaughter weight (SW) and strategy (SS) on carcass a nd meat quality, sexual organ development and boar taint in entire males. Twelve pens of 10 pigs were used (two trials). Half of male pens were allowed visual contact with females (MF) and half with males (MM). Half MM or MF were slaughtered at 105 or 130 kg in trial 1, or penwise or by split marketing in trial 2 at 120 kg. Housing system showed no significant effect on carcass or meat quality. MF presented significantly longer testicles and heavier bulbourethral glands compared to MM. The distribution of androstenone and skatole levels was affected by SW but not by HS or SS, samples with androstenone >1 μg/g of the different groups falling within the range of 16 to 22%. All correlations between androstenone and sex organs were significant. Housing system and slaughter strategy did not reduce the risk of boar tainted carcasses.  相似文献

The aim of the study was to evaluate the effect of immunocastration on meat and carcass quality compared with meat from females, entire and surgically castrated males. One hundred and eighteen (Landrace × Duroc) × Pietrain crossbred pigs were assigned to four experimental groups: entire males (EM), females (FE), surgically castrated males (CM) and vaccinated males (IM). Pigs were reared in two pens per sex and slaughtered at an average of 180 days of age. Carcass and meat quality characteristics such as testis size and length, fat depth, lean content, proportion of the carcass represented by each joint, pH, colour and intramuscular fat were evaluated. There was a significant reduction in the size of these sexual organs in IM compared with EM. CM and IM were fatter than FE and EM in the loin area but, in the ham area, CM was the fattest and EM the leanest, while IM and FE were in between. Intramuscular fat of IM (2.1%) was no different from the other sexes evaluated, although it was higher in CM (2.5%) with respect to FE (1.7%) and EM (1.8%). There was no difference between the IM and other treatment groups in meat quality. Regarding ours results we can conclude that from the point of view of meat and carcass quality the immunocastration could be a good alternative to the surgical castration.  相似文献

Boar taint is a sensory defect mainly due to androstenone and skatole. The most common method to control boar taint is surgical castration at an early age. Vaccination against gonadotropin releasing factor (also known as immunocastration) is an alternative to surgical castration to reduce androstenone content. In this experiment, loins from 24 female (FE), 24 entire male (EM), 24 vaccinated males (IM) and 23 surgically castrated males (CM) were evaluated by eight trained panellists in 24 sessions. Loins were cooked in an oven at 180 °C for 10 min. Furthermore loins were evaluated by consumers and its androstenone and skatole content were also chemically determined. Meat from EM had higher androstenone and skatole odour and flavour than meat from FE, IM and CM and lower sweetness odour scores. High correlations were found between androstenone and skatole levels assessed by trained panelists, chemical analysis and consumers’ acceptability. Moreover meat from EM is mainly related to androstenone and skatole attributes.  相似文献

A novel SIDA-DI-SPME-GC/MS procedure for the quantitation of skatole in pork meat juice was developed and validated as a substitute for back fat sample analysis. System suitability was evaluated by determining the correlation between skatole concentrations in a subset of 38 paired meat juice and back fat samples selected from 90 fattened boars. High correlation was observed between both matrices and conclusions about the partitioning of skatole as well as of androstenone between fat and lean compartments in vivo were drawn.  相似文献

Transglutaminase is an enzyme that can be used to cross-link pieces of meat, fish or meat products. The resulting product gives the optical impression of an intact chunk of meat. The usage of transglutaminase as a food additive is permitted in some countries. However, its utilisation has to be declared to ensure transparency for consumers. This paper describes two orthogonal analytical methods suited for the detection of technological relevant transglutaminase concentrations (around 25?mg pure enzyme in 1?kg of product) in meat and meat products. The mass spectrometry-based approach relies on a previous digestion with Achromobacter lyticus protease and LC-MS/MS separation and detection. Sufficient selectivity was obtained by monitoring four different peptides. The orthogonal (complementary and independent), ELISA-based approach relies on two commercially available bacterial transglutaminase-specific antibodies, combined to a sandwich ELISA. The two methods were tested by analysing some 60 samples obtained from the market.  相似文献

The aim of this study was to compare production, carcass and meat quality parameters, boar taint compounds and fat composition of green and dry-cured hams, between immunocastrated (IM), surgically castrated (CM) and female (FE) Duroc purebred pigs (n=75, 138.7±8.27kg). Liveweight and fat and muscle thicknesses were measured and average daily gain was calculated during growth. Carcass, meat and fat quality parameters were measured. Immunocastrated grew faster than CM or FE after the second dose of vaccine. IM had the lowest dressing percentage but similar % of ham and carcass lean to FE and CM. The effect of the immunocastration on carcass fatness depended on the location, did not affect fat and meat quality and reduced skatole and androstenone levels. Both in green and dry-cured ham, immunocastration slightly altered FA composition. Thus, Duroc pigs vaccinated with Improvac are suitable for the production of high quality dry-cured ham.  相似文献

The purpose of this study was to compare the muscle histochemical characteristics and meat quality traits between Berkshire, Landrace, Yorkshire, and crossbred pigs. A total of 594 pigs were evaluated. A clear difference between histochemical properties was observed from the results for fiber type composition. In Berkshire pigs, the area percentage of type I fibers was higher (P < 0.001) and that of type IIb fibers was lower (P < 0.05) than those of other breeds. The muscle pH45min and pH24h were significantly higher in Berkshire pigs. Drip loss and color parameters were significantly different between the breeds (P < 0.001). The Berkshire pigs, which showed the highest muscle pH and lowest drip loss and L* values, contained a significantly higher percentage of type I fibers than the other breeds. By comparing the fiber type compositions of the different breeds, the results imply that the longissimus dorsi muscle of Berkshire pigs is more oxidative than that of other breeds. A high pH value in Berkshire pigs is due to a high percentage of type I fibers and a low percentage of type IIb fibers. Based on these results, we conclude that muscle fiber composition can explain in parts the variation of meat quality across and within breeds.  相似文献

格里斯试剂比色法测定肉制品中亚硝酸盐含量   总被引:2,自引:0,他引:2  
采用格里斯试荆比色法测定市场上常见的火腿类产品中亚硝酸盐的含量,结果表明:采用格里斯试刺比色法测定肉制品中的亚硝酸钠含量时选择的最大吸收波长应为550 nm,实验得到的标准方程为y=0.0 181x 0.0034,相关系数R2=0.9995,线性良好.该方法测定时重复性和稳定性均较好,重复操作过程中产生的误差较小,样品处理后在2 h内完成测定即可.另外,通过回收性实验还证明该方法的回收率较高,在96%以上.样品在测定的时间内稳定性和重复操作读取的数值不会有变化.  相似文献

Skatole, androstenone and other compounds such as indole cause boar taint in entire male pork. However, female pigs also produce skatole and indole. The purpose of this experiment was to minimise boar taint and increase overall impression of sensory quality by feeding entire male and female pigs with fibre-rich feedstuffs. The pigs have been fed three organic diets for either 1 or 2 weeks prior to slaughter of which two diets contained different fermentable fibre-rich feedstuffs – 10–13.3% dried chicory roots or 25% blue lupines. These two treatments were compared with pigs fed with an organic control diet for either 1 or 2 weeks prior to slaughter. Lupines significantly reduced skatole in blood and backfat for both genders after 1 week. Moreover, lupines showed negative impact on growth rate and feed conversion whilst chicory showed no significant differences in this respect. However, the indole concentration was significantly lower in chicory than lupine fed pigs. From a sensory perspective, chicory and lupine feeding reduced boar taint since odour and flavour of manure related to skatole and urine associated to androstenone were minimised. The level of boar taint in the entire male pigs was most effectively reduced after 14 days by both fibre-rich feeds while lupine had the largest influence on “boar” taint reduction in female pigs.  相似文献
